Description

This vibrant scene, presumably somewhere deep in the jungle of Africa, was created to accompany the Jungle Jump Up Game, issued in 1964 by the Kellogg Company as a mail-in prize for cornflake consumers.

Each spot represents the location of a wild animal, with point numbers corresponding to the shot difficulty for the ‘hunter.’ Instructions on the verso shows how to assemble each animal and its rubber-banded target, causing them to jump when hit by a bullet (not included).
